A First Look At The Crime of The (Literal) Century in Smooth Criminals from Kirsten “Kiwi” Smith and Kurt Lustgarten!

BOOM! Studios has unveiled a first look at Smooth Criminals #1, the new original ongoing series beginning November 21st from the acclaimed screenwriter Kirsten “Kiwi” Smith and Kurt Lustgarten, the writing duo behind the smash hit Misfit City, and artist Leisha Riddel.

There are certain things Brenda expects to find while hacking: money, secrets, occasional pictures of cats. She is NOT expecting to find a cryogenically frozen master thief named Mia from the ’60s. Mia is everything Brenda is not—cool, confident, beautiful. And utterly unprepared for the digital age. Despite their differences, the two will need to team up to find out what happened to Mia—and how to pull off the biggest heist of the ’90s.

Smooth Criminals #1 features a main cover by Audrey Mok and a variant cover by Chynna Clugston Flores.

Synopsis:

Nothing’s happened in Wilder’s hometown since they filmed the cult kids’ adventure movie The Gloomies there in the ’80s. Now Cannon Cove is just a boring tourist trap where nothing ever happens… until she and her friends come upon a centuries-old pirate map drawn by someone named Black Mary!

It’s a rip-roaring adventure written by award-winning screenwriter Kirsten “Kiwi” Smith (10 Things I Hate About You, Legally Blonde) and Kurt Lustgarten, and illustrated by Naomi Franquiz.
Collects issues #1-4.

Misfit City Extended for Second Story Arc

The critically acclaimed Misfit City, from screenwriter Kirsten “Kiwi” Smith, co-writer Kurt Lustgarten, and artist Naomi Franquiz, kicks off its climactic second story arc in September as the hunt for Black Mary’s treasure reaches a dramatic conclusion, BOOM! Studios announced today.

Misfit City is the story of Wilder and her friends, whose hometown is where they filmed that cult kids’ adventure movie in the ’80s. Nothing ever happens there, until one day they come upon a centuries-old treasure map drawn by the infamous pirate Black Mary, launching a life-imitates-art adventure in the town they all dreamed of escaping.

Retailers, please note Misfit City #5 has an FOC date of August 28 and on-sale date of September 20. Misfit City Vol. 1, a softcover collecting the first four issues, is also available for pre-order and comes out in December.
